Lukas Graham Australian Tour

Australia won't need to wait for 7 years to see ARIA album and single chart topper Lukas Graham perform 'cause he is heading on his way down under for the very first time this August.

Lukas will be doing two debut performances in Melbourne and Sydney, filling both venues with his hip-hop infused pop-soul sound.

With his track ‘7 Years’ amassing more than 200 million streams and 162 million YouTube views globally, and climbing and dominating the charts in close to 20 countries across the globe, Lukas Graham comes as one of 2016’s breakthrough artists.

Similarly, Graham’s self-titled debut album (out now via Warner Music Australia) landed at #1 on the ARIA Albums Chart upon its release last month. To create the eleven-track collection, Graham drew from both his experiences and eclectic record collection that includes the likes of The Beatles, Gregory Isaacs, Al Green and The Prodigy.

Graham's distinct sound is comprised of the contrasting influences of his father’s Irish folk roots and his own passion for hip hop along with his classical training with the Copenhagen Boys’ Choir. Stories of Graham’s upbringing in Christiania, a self-governed district of central Copenhagen with no cars, streetlights, or police, are scattered through his debut album.

Before even capturing the world's attention, Graham had already caught Europe's attention with multiplatinum albums, top 10 singles and countless sold out shows and festival main stage spots to his name. In Denmark alone, cumulative single sales have surpassed 150,000 with nearly 40 million collective streams.

Graham’s bandmates – and childhood friends – Mark “Lovestick” Falgren (drums), Magnús “Magnúm” Larsson (bass), and Kasper Daugaard (keyboard) all play an important part in both the songwriting process and their renowned live show. Xavier Dunn will join Graham for his debut Australian shows. Dunn’s vocals and cutting edge production will be the perfect complement to Graham’s prowess on the live stage. The Sydneysider already had a long list of accolades under his belt before even releasing his debut single ‘Scattered’ last month.

His unique cover renditions have earned him three tracks that reached the coveted top spot on HypeMachine, 1.5million SoundCloud plays, 3 million plays in just over a month on Spotify and the #1 position on Spotify’s US and Australian Viral Charts as well as the #2 Global Viral position.
